diff --git a/platform-independent/java/gui/src/main/java/com/lyndir/masterpassword/gui/view/UserContentPanel.java b/platform-independent/java/gui/src/main/java/com/lyndir/masterpassword/gui/view/UserContentPanel.java
index 21714b15..8af646da 100644
--- a/platform-independent/java/gui/src/main/java/com/lyndir/masterpassword/gui/view/UserContentPanel.java
+++ b/platform-independent/java/gui/src/main/java/com/lyndir/masterpassword/gui/view/UserContentPanel.java
@@ -856,12 +856,12 @@ public class UserContentPanel extends JPanel implements MasterPassword.Listener,
private void useSite(final ActionEvent event) {
MPSite> site = getSite();
- if (site instanceof MPNewSite) {
- if (JOptionPane.YES_OPTION != JOptionPane.showConfirmDialog(
- this, strf( "Remember the site %s?", site.getSiteName() ),
- "New Site", JOptionPane.YES_NO_OPTION ))
- return;
-
+ if (site instanceof MPNewSite &&
+ JOptionPane.YES_OPTION == JOptionPane.showConfirmDialog(
+ this,
+ strf("Remember the site %s?", site.getSiteName()),
+ "New Site",
+ JOptionPane.YES_NO_OPTION)) {
site = ((MPNewSite) site).addTo( user );
}